-
公开(公告)号:CN104023039A
公开(公告)日:2014-09-03
申请号:CN201310064524.2
申请日:2013-02-28
申请人: 国际商业机器公司
IPC分类号: H04L29/08 , H04L12/951
摘要: 本发明公开了一种数据包传输方法和装置。所述方法包括:确定具有相同目的地并且结构相同的多个常规数据包;确定所述多个常规数据包在汇总节点进行汇总运算的至少一个数据字段以及该数据字段的汇总运算类型;生成与所述多个常规数据包结构相同的先导数据包,在所述先导数据包中记载所确定的所述进行汇总运算的至少一个数据字段以及该数据字段的汇总运算类型;在发送所述多个常规数据包之前发送所述先导数据包。本发明实施例的装置与上述方法对应。利用本发明实施例的方法和装置,可以改善数据包传输的效率。
-
公开(公告)号:CN102722412A
公开(公告)日:2012-10-10
申请号:CN201110079617.3
申请日:2011-03-31
申请人: 国际商业机器公司
IPC分类号: G06F9/50
CPC分类号: G06F9/5066
摘要: 提供一种组合计算装置和方法,所述装置包括:输入设定单元,配置为接收与多组输入数据相关的第一设定和与所述多组输入数据之间的组合方式相关的第二设定;数据获取单元,配置为根据所述第一设定和第二设定,获取由多组输入数据构成的数据组合;以及至少一个组合操作单元,配置为对所述数据组合进行所需的计算操作。本发明还提供了与上述装置对应的系统和方法。通过上述装置和方法,改进了现有的并行计算方式,使得并行计算的设计和操作更加简单,提高了并行计算系统的性能和效率。
-
公开(公告)号:CN104598304A
公开(公告)日:2015-05-06
申请号:CN201310531204.3
申请日:2013-10-31
申请人: 国际商业机器公司
CPC分类号: G06F9/505 , G06F9/50 , G06F9/5044
摘要: 本发明涉及用于作业执行中的调度的方法和装置。根据本发明的实施例,提供一种在执行作业中调度由一个或多个前处理机和一个或多个后处理机共享的多个作业槽的方法,所述前处理机产生的数据将被馈送给所述后处理机以便处理。该方法包括:确定所述前处理机的总体数据产生速度;确定所述后处理机的总体数据消耗速度;以及基于所述总体数据产生速度和所述总体数据消耗速度,调度至少一个所述作业槽在所述前处理机和所述后处理机之间的分配。还公开了相应的装置。
-
公开(公告)号:CN101996082B
公开(公告)日:2014-06-11
申请号:CN200910168620.5
申请日:2009-08-28
申请人: 国际商业机器公司
IPC分类号: G06F9/445
CPC分类号: G06F9/445 , G06F9/3881 , G06F2212/251 , G06F2212/253
摘要: 本发明公开了一种协处理器系统以及在协处理器系统的本地存储器上加载应用程序的方法,其中,本地存储器包含加载区和非加载区,加载区中存储着加载器和应用程序的待加载可执行映象的描述数据,加载器包含可重定位代码,该方法包含:将可重定位代码和描述数据从加载区复制到非加载区;被复制到非加载区的可重定位代码根据描述数据加载所述待加载可执行映象。采用本发明系统和方法,可以在不占用额外存储空间的情况下,提高协处理器系统应用程序开发的灵活性。
-
-
公开(公告)号:CN102651690A
公开(公告)日:2012-08-29
申请号:CN201110047985.X
申请日:2011-02-28
申请人: 国际商业机器公司
CPC分类号: H04L49/901 , G06F9/544 , G06F15/167
摘要: 针对分布式应用程序的特点,本发明提出了一种在网卡上应用共享内存的技术方案。具体而言,本发明提供了一种网卡,包括:共享内存,被配置为为分布式应用程序的任务提供共享的存储空间,并且所述共享内存可以被运行同一任务的多个计算节点访问,以及微控制器,被配置为对所述共享内存进行读写操作的控制。此外本发明还提供了一种包括上述网卡的计算机设备,一种对网卡的共享内存进行读写操作控制的方法,和一种对网卡进行调用的方法。采用本发明所提供的技术方案,绕过了网络协议堆栈的处理过程,避免了网络协议堆栈所带来的时间延迟,本发明无需对数据包进行TCP/IP封装,大大节省了TCP/IP层数据封装所带来的额外包头包尾开销。
-
-
公开(公告)号:CN104598304B
公开(公告)日:2018-03-13
申请号:CN201310531204.3
申请日:2013-10-31
申请人: 国际商业机器公司
CPC分类号: G06F9/505 , G06F9/50 , G06F9/5044
摘要: 本发明涉及用于作业执行中的调度的方法和装置。根据本发明的实施例,提供一种在执行作业中调度由一个或多个前处理机和一个或多个后处理机共享的多个作业槽的方法,所述前处理机产生的数据将被馈送给所述后处理机以便处理。该方法包括:确定所述前处理机的总体数据产生速度;确定所述后处理机的总体数据消耗速度;以及基于所述总体数据产生速度和所述总体数据消耗速度,调度至少一个所述作业槽在所述前处理机和所述后处理机之间的分配。还公开了相应的装置。
-
公开(公告)号:CN104023039B
公开(公告)日:2018-02-02
申请号:CN201310064524.2
申请日:2013-02-28
申请人: 国际商业机器公司
IPC分类号: H04L29/08 , H04L12/951
摘要: 本发明公开了一种数据包传输方法和装置。所述方法包括:确定具有相同目的地并且结构相同的多个常规数据包;确定所述多个常规数据包在汇总节点进行汇总运算的至少一个数据字段以及该数据字段的汇总运算类型;生成与所述多个常规数据包结构相同的先导数据包,在所述先导数据包中记载所确定的所述进行汇总运算的至少一个数据字段以及该数据字段的汇总运算类型;在发送所述多个常规数据包之前发送所述先导数据包。本发明实施例的装置与上述方法对应。利用本发明实施例的方法和装置,可以改善数据包传输的效率。
-
公开(公告)号:CN103139265B
公开(公告)日:2016-06-08
申请号:CN201110393703.1
申请日:2011-12-01
申请人: 国际商业机器公司
IPC分类号: H04L29/08
CPC分类号: H04L67/1004 , G06F11/3006 , G06F11/3017 , G06F11/3065 , G06F11/3433 , H04L41/0896 , H04L41/26 , H04L45/16
摘要: 本发明公开涉及大规模并行计算系统中的网络传输自适应优化方法及系统。所述网络传输自适应优化方法包括:基于获得的关于计算节点所执行的任务的信息形成要经由网络传输的消息,其中所述消息包括要进行数据传输的计算节点和对应的汇总节点的标识信息以及所述计算节点要传送给所述对应的汇总节点的数据量;将所述消息发送到网络层;以及根据接收到的消息,为所述计算节点和所述对应的汇总节点之间的数据传输形成新的数据传输模式。
-
-
-
-
-
-
-
-
-